mouth absorption Oral absorption of material. Some substances, but no nutrients, can be absorbed from the mouth; some drugs, esp. alkaloids, can be absorbed through the oral mucosa.

mouth prop A metal or rubber device inserted between the jaws to maintain the mouth in an open position. SYN: bite block.

mouth rinse A flavored solution swished and swirled in the mouth, and used to reduce oral pain or halitosis, or to treat oral infections, apthous ulcers, stomatitis, or dental plaque.
